Check the beginning of file content to learn which programming language
in the content.
The detected lang type will be applied only if php, xml, html or bash is
detected.
The language type is determinated via file extension, if the file
extension is unknown or the determinated lang type is different from
the detected value, then the detected lang type via the file content
will be used.

This feature got a lot of regression due to its dependency on dropbox,
google drive and one drive implementation. This modification removes
such dependecy and allow users to set their settings location - any
cloud location path and even customized local location.

When loading a file via `FileManager::loadFileData`, a fixed-length buffer
is filled via `fread`. Then, in some cases, a conversion is done with the help
of `Utf8_16_Read`. However, the method `Utf8_16_Read::convert` performs a call
to `strlen` on this buffer. This is obviously wrong: `\0` char should be
accepted (even if a bit strange) and the buffer is not zero-terminated.
The changes merely consist in adding an additional parameter `length` to
not have to guess the size of the buffer.
The method `FileManager::loadFileData` uses a stack-based buffer for reading
a file. However, due to the optimization used by `Utf8_16_Read` (`UnicodeConvertor`),
this buffer is not copied, but a pointer to this object is kept.
After `loadFileData`, this object is destroyed, but is used afterward
(via `UnicodeConvertor.getNewBuf`).
